July 2026: What I've Been Working On · Danb Blog
2026-08-02 · via Danb Blog

Heat waves in the UK have continued in July which, when combined with a little arthritis flaring, has kept me in a mind-melted sleepy mode for much of the month 🫠.

BookStack

It’s mostly been maintenance work this month while focusing on other things.

Another couple of security releases pushed out this month. The rate of, and therefore time consumed by, security reports is still quite intense. Within 24 hours of releasing v26.05.3 I was sent a further 7 vulnerability reports to handle. Most of these are invalid or need no action, but even with those they require time to review, check and respond to.

yphp

Finished off my PHP implementation of Yrs/Y.js. All main functions of the underlying C library are now implemented, providing a high level of feature coverage, with testing to cover. Quite enjoyed putting together some hand-written user guidance for the library.

xemlock/htmlpurifier

Created a pull request for this HTMLPurifier addon to add full srcset attribute parsing. It was interesting to read & follow the exact parsing logic of a WHATWG spec for the first time.

This was essentially an upstreaming of code created to address a reported BookStack vulnerability scenario.

IsItReallyFOSS

Made a few small updates this month, although still going slow. Still trying to find the best way to work on this more frequently.

The most interesting project for the month was for OpenVPN, added by frequent contributor Esmenard. Shame to see yet another project with “Open” in the name use its branding to mostly push non-FOSS offerings.

Put out a little release mainly to bump up dependencies. Ran into issues testing locally since recently switching to podman, so also made the container work better in rootless environments by allowing the webserver port to be configured via env variable.

I did think about maybe upgrading the container to use FrankenPHP, but the FrankenPHP binary alone is a lot larger than my existing container image build, so I decided against that to keep things small and efficient.
